Ojo Michael Akindele is a Nigerian. He had National Diploma in General Agriculture in 1992. In 1999, he graduated from Federal University of Technology, Akure, Nigeria with Second Class Honour (Upper Division) in Agricultural Economics and Extension. He also obtained M.Sc. and Ph.D Agricultural Economics. He joined the service of Federal University of Technology Minna, Nigeria in 2007 as Lecturer II in the Department of Agricultural Economics and Extension Technology. He grew through the ranks and became Professor of Agricultural Economics in 2019.
He has over 15 years of teaching and research experience in the area of Agricultural Production Economics with special interest in establishing and improving the efficiency and productivity of farmers with the aim of enhancing food production and security. Moreover, he has conducted researches ranging from small, medium and large-scale farm production with the aim of identifying the factors and constraints that affect the food crop and poultry farmers production, productivity and efficiency in order to proffer solutions to them thereby increasing food security status of the people. He has supervised and still supervising undergraduate, Master and PhD students. He has over 80 publications covering his areas of research interest. He has also taught Introductory Economics, Introduction to Agricultural Economics, Agricultural marketing, Econometrics and Application of computer to agriculture at undergraduate level, Mathematical Economics and Advanced Statistics and Research Methodology at Postgraduate level. He has also been involved in research consultancy in various Federal Government and World Bank Assisted Projects
